The Evolution of Car Keys
1. Traditional Keys:
In the early days of automotive history, car keys were simple metal cut keys, utilized exclusively to mechanically unlock doors and start the vehicle. These conventional keys were easy to replicate however didn't use much in regards to security.
2. Transponder Keys:
Introduced in the mid-1990s, transponder keys reinvented automotive security. Embedded with Car Locksmiths , these keys send out a distinct signal to the car's ignition system. Automobiles will just begin if they recognize the right signal, adding a layer of security against theft.
3. Remote Key Fobs:
Remote key fobs permit keyless entry, making it practical for users to access their vehicles with the touch of a button. These fobs generally also control car alarms, supplying additional security features.
4. Smart Keys and Keyless Ignition:
The latest in automotive key technology, wise keys or distance keys enable users to start and stop the vehicle with a push-button ignition system. They enable the vehicle to recognize when the key is nearby, providing exceptional benefit and security.
The Role of a Car Locksmith
Car locksmiths are extremely proficient specialists who focus on a variety of services. Here are a few of their main obligations:
Key Replacement and Duplication:
Whether due to loss, theft, or damage, replacing car keys is among the most typical jobs carried out by locksmith professionals. With their knowledge, they can replicate and replace traditional, transponder, and even some wise keys.
Lockout Services:
Being locked out of a vehicle is a typical problem dealt with by numerous chauffeurs. Locksmiths take advantage of specialized tools and techniques to securely open car doors without triggering any damage.
Ignition Repair and Replacement:
Issues with a car's ignition system can avoid a vehicle from beginning. Locksmiths assess these problems and can repair or replace ignitions as required.
Programming Transponder Keys:
Given the complexity associated with transponder keys, locksmiths often assist with programming them to interact with a vehicle's ignition system.
Advanced Security System Installation:
Modern automobiles often come geared up with advanced security systems. Car locksmiths use setup and maintenance services for these innovative systems to ensure they function correctly.
The Technology Behind Lock and Key Security
Developments in innovation have changed how locksmith professionals work. Here's a glance into some of the key innovations utilized today:
- Laser Key Cutting: Laser cutting devices are utilized for high accuracy, making sure keys fit completely into their particular locks.
- OBD-II Programming Tools: On-Board Diagnostics (OBD) tools help locksmith professionals in accessing a car's computer system to program keys, especially for newer designs.
- Key Code Retrieval: Modern locksmiths can retrieve unique car key codes from producers, allowing accurate duplication and programming.
FAQs About Car Key and Locksmith Services
What should I do if I lose my car keys?
- Contact a professional locksmith who can replace your keys. Ensure to offer evidence of ownership for the vehicle.
Can a locksmith make a key for a car without the original?
- Yes, many locksmiths can create a key using the vehicle's ignition lock or by retrieving the key code.
How long does it take to replace a car key?
- The time can differ depending upon the key type and the locksmith's accessibility, with traditional keys taking less time compared to transponder and clever keys.
Is it cheaper to go to a locksmith or a dealer for key replacement?
- Generally, locksmith professionals provide more economical services compared to car dealerships for key replacement services.
Can locksmiths program all types of car keys?
- While most locksmiths can deal with a vast array of keys, some state-of-the-art designs might need specific services readily available just through the car dealership.
